Responsibilities
Must have a practical knowledge of theory, principles, practice and techniques of asepsis to prevent the spread of infection.
Must have a practical knowledge of microbiology and the principles as they apply to surgical supply operations as they relate to the resistance of microorganisms to external destructive agents such as heat and chemicals used for sterilization and High Level Disinfection (HLD).
Must have a working knowledge of standard procedures for steam autoclaving.
Must have a working knowledge of standard procedures for use of chemical sterilization such as Sterrad.
Interpretation and proper recording of results of all sterilization tests.
Must have a working knowledge of standard procedures for use of HLD systems such as Medivator Advantage, Trophon, and manual HLD utilizing Cidex OPA.
Must have a good working knowledge of the availability, economics, use, operation, maintenance, assembly and disassembly of the full range of surgical supplies, instruments, equipment and the specific cleaning, sterilizing and storage requirements of each.
Must possess a very broad knowledge of all types of surgical and clinical instrumentation. This knowledge must include sufficient working knowledge to be able to identify damaged or broken instruments, and be able to find a suitable replacement item if available.
Must have a thorough familiarity with surgical procedures performed in a hospital Operating Room.
Must have knowledge of medical and surgical terminology, human anatomy, and physiology.
Must have a thorough knowledge of aseptic principles and techniques including characteristics of various types of detergents, and cleaning techniques.
Must have knowledge of the proper handling, cleaning, and reprocessing for use of flexible endoscopes such as colonoscopes and gastroscopes.
Must be able to fallow detailed, step by step instructions provided by the manufacturer for the handling, cleaning, and sterilization or HLD processing of a large variety of surgical and clinical Reusable Medical Equipment (RME).

How much does a sterile processing technician earn in Glendora, CA?
The average sterile processing technician in Glendora, CA earns between $40,000 and $79,000 annually. This compares to the national average sterile processing technician range of $29,000 to $50,000.
Average sterile processing technician salary in Glendora, CA
$56,000
